Leveraging Bonuses and Promotions Effectively

Online sportsbooks frequently offer bonuses and promotions to attract new customers and retain existing ones. These can include welcome bonuses, deposit matches, free bets, and loyalty programs. While these offers can be enticing, it's crucial to understand the terms and conditions attached to them. Pay attention to wagering requirements, which dictate how many times you need to bet the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ings. Also, be mindful of any restrictions on the types of bets that qualify for the bonus. Treat bonuses as a valuable tool to enhance your wagering experience, but don't let them cloud your judgment or lead to reckless betting behavior.

  • Welcome Bonuses: Typically offered to new customers upon registration.
  • Deposit Matches: The sportsbook matches a percentage of your initial deposit.
  • Free Bets: Allow you to place a bet without risking your own money.
  • Loyalty Programs: Reward frequent bettors with exclusive bonuses and benefits.

Carefully evaluating the terms and conditions of any bonus or promotion is essential to maximizing its value and avoiding potential pitfalls. A seemingly generous offer may come with hidden caveats that make it less attractive than it initially appears.

Understanding Different Betting Types

The world of sports betting offers a wide array of wagering options, each with its own level of risk and potential reward. Understanding these different types is crucial for developing a successful betting strategy. Simple bets, such as moneyline wagers (picking the winner of a game) and spread bets (betting on a team to win by a certain margin), are relatively straightforward. More complex options include parlays (combining multiple bets into one), futures (betting on events that will occur in the future), and prop bets (betting on specific events within a game). Each wager type carries different odds and implications, adapting to your knowledge and risk tolerance is vital. Some bettors prefer the higher potential payout of parlays, while others prefer the more predictable nature of spread bets.

Managing Risk and Bankroll

Effective bankroll management is arguably the most important aspect of successful wagering. It involves setting a budget for your betting activities and sticking to it, regardless of wins or losses. Never bet more than you can afford to lose, and avoid chasing your losses. A common rule of thumb is to risk only 1-5% of your bankroll on any single bet. This helps to mitigate the impact of losing bets and preserves your capital for future opportunities. Furthermore, diversify your bets across different sports and events to reduce your overall risk. Treat wagering as a long-term investment and avoid impulsive decisions based on emotion.

  1. Set a Budget: Determine how much money you are willing to risk.
  2. Stake Management: Limit the amount wagered on each bet (1-5%).
  3. Diversify Bets: Spread your wagers across different events.
  4. Avoid Chasing Losses: Don’t increase bets to recoup losses.

Disciplined bankroll management is the cornerstone of responsible wagering and is essential for maximizing your long-term profitability.

The Importance of Responsible Gaming

Wagering should be viewed as a form of entertainment, not a source of income. It’s crucial to approach it with a responsible mindset and recognize the potential risks involved. The most important advice is to only wager with funds you can afford to lose. Set limits on your time and money spent wagering, and stick to them. Recognize the signs of problem gambling, such as spending increasing amounts of money, chasing losses, and neglecting personal responsibilities. If you or someone you know is struggling with gambling addiction, seek help from a qualified professional. Resources are readily available to provide support and guidance, and reaching out is a sign of strength, not weakness.
